What The Per Diem Calculation Looks Like On A Truck Driver Tax Return? Per diem is one of those deductions truck drivers hear about constantly but rarely understand in detail. It sounds simple on the surface, a daily rate for meals and expenses while you’re on the road, but the actual calculation has rules most drivers never bother learning until they’re sitting across from someone doing their taxes wondering why the number looks different than they expected. Here’s how per diem actually works on a return. Per Diem Covers Meals And Incidentals, Not Everything A lot of drivers assume per diem is some broad catch-all for anything spent on the road, but it’s specifically meant for meals and incidental expenses. It doesn’t cover lodging, fuel, or maintenance, those get handled as separate deductions entirely.
